Galatasaray to sign Nigeria’s Victor Osimhen in $87 million deal

Galatasaray are set to complete the most expensive transfer in Turkish football history as Victor Osimhen prepares to sign a permanent deal this Saturday. After a sensational loan spell from Napoli—scoring 37 goals and 8 assists in 41 matches—the Nigerian striker will join for $87 million (€75 million), shattering Süper Lig records and signalling Galatasaray’s European ambitions.

Negotiations with Napoli were tough, with president Aurelio De Laurentiis holding out for Osimhen’s full release clause. The deal will see Galatasaray pay €40 million upfront and €35 million in installments, plus up to €5 million in bonuses. Napoli also secured a 10% sell-on clause and blocked any transfer to another Serie A club until July 2027.

Osimhen, turning down massive offers from Al-Hilal and several Premier League giants, chose to stay with Galatasaray, citing his bond with fans and coach Okan Buruk. He’ll earn up to €18 million per year on a three-year deal—one of the highest in Süper Lig history.

The move comes amid a major squad overhaul, with Galatasaray also signing Leroy Sané and reshuffling their squad for a Champions League campaign. Osimhen’s arrival is set to fire up Istanbul, with a grand unveiling at RAMS Park—ending a transfer saga that captivated fans across Turkey and Italy.
